Abstract:
We prove the consistency of: if B_1, B_2 are Boolean algebra satisfying the c.c.c. and the 2^{\aleph_0}-c.c. respectively then B_1 \times B_2 satisfies the 2^{\aleph_0}-c.c. - Version 1995-09-15_10 (15p) published version (11p)
